Frankfurt am Main (FRA) to Rzeszow (RZE)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Frankfurt am Main International Airport (FRA) in Frankfurt am Main, Germany to Rzeszow-Jasionka Airport (RZE) in Rzeszow, Poland is 961 kilometers (597 miles / 519 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 2h, flying east at a heading of 84°.

This is a short-haul route typically served by narrow-body aircraft such as the Boeing 737 or Airbus A320 family. In-flight service is usually limited to drinks and light snacks.

This is an international route connecting Germany with Poland.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 06:08 in Frankfurt am Main, it's 06:08 in Rzeszow.

The return flight from Rzeszow (RZE) to Frankfurt am Main (FRA) follows a heading of 275° (west).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
